Genetic Variants in OUD Risk Algorithm Do Not Meet Standards in Identifying Risk
Christal N. Davis, PhD Credit: ResearchGate A recent study suggested that the genetic variants in the opioid use disorder (OUD) risk algorithm do not meet reasonable standards in identifying OUD risk.1 “We found no evidence to support the clinical utility of the 15 [single nucleotide variants] purported to predict OUD risk,” wrote investigators, led by … Read more
